Magazine Analysis 3


This is one my favourite album covers I have ever seen. It’s an exclusive issue which was only available to subscribers of Q magazine. The magazine features the thoughts, lyrics and other information about Alex Turner from the well-known band; Arctic Monkeys. The main image is a close up of the main man Alex Turner. Although he isn’t looking directing into the reader’s eyes he has a thoughtful look on his face. This relates to the articles that will be featured in the magazine. The typical Q masthead has been cleverly placed overlapping his head, it almost acts as a thought bubble and gives the impression that the entire front cover was inspired by his thoughts. There is very little printed writing on the front cover but there are handwritten lyrics in the background, which have been made to look like they have been written by Alex himself, and give a more personal touch. This is used to reflect Alex’s deep and intensive thoughts and shows that Q are so well-established, they can interview and have an entire feature magazine on one of the best musicians to this day. The small amounts of text reflect on how exclusive the issue actually is. ‘Inside Alex Turners Head’ - Q are one of the only magazines that have accessed this information and it is ‘exclusive’ to their habituated subscribers. The scribbling and uneven writing could suggest a sense of rebellion. It isn’t hand writing someone of the high class would produce, but of a middle class, mid 20’s individual.
